Title of article :
Secondary succession of spontaneous flora after deforestation and self-reforestation

Abstract :
The experimental plots are located on a farm in a mountainous area at an altitude of 845 m above the sea level with the soil type cambisol. After leaving pasture grassland in about 50 years created a forest community with 45.06 per cent share of woody plants. After it has been deforested was doing research on a variant grazing with Charolais cattle and compared with deforested grassland without management leaving the development without human intervention. On the variant without management for three years we recorded 58 plant species with woody plants. Cover of grasses was reduced,for example Agrostis capillaris L. from 15 to 0.78% and Festuca rubra from 5,33 to the tracks,like the presence of herbs,on the contrary increased the percentage of woody plants as Betula pendula from 4.08 to 13.52%,Cerasus avium from 3.07 to 16 28% and Populus tremula from 16.22 to 47.88%. Proportion of woody plants in the third year of research accounted for up to 77.68 per cent stake. Dominant Populus tremula amounted to 2.50 m high and mean diameter 30 mm. Grazing control variant for three years consisted of community - Agrostis Festucetum rubrae with 66 plant species and dominance of other herbs (53.66%). Significantly increased the proportion of grasses,for example Agrostis capillaris from 5.67 to 15.61%,Festuca rubra from 5.02 to 8.42%,Festuca pratensis from 3.84 to 4.40% and Dactylis glomerata from 2.46 to 4.46%. The variant without management significantly increased levels of C : N at depths of 0-200mm from 10.88-12.65 to 14-16.53,compared with a variant of grazing (from 9.36-12.41 to 6.93-10.46). The evaluation of phosphorus and potassium in two depths,in the C : N ratio,but also in botanical composition from 2006 to 2008,we found statistically highly significant differences in the variant with self-reforestation without management (BM) compared with grazing control variant after deforestation.
